Use this skill to create, update, or inspect dashboards in Apache Superset.
The data you need is already in a table inside a Superset-connected database —
gen_dashboard does not move data. Your job: register the dataset, build
charts, assemble the dashboard, validate.
Follow these steps in order. Each step depends on the output of the previous one.
list_bi_databases()
Match the orchestrator-provided bi_database_name against the returned
name, and pick the corresponding id — that's your database_id for every
create_dataset call below. If no match, bail with a structured error naming
the missing DB.

create_dashboard)create_dashboard(title="Dashboard Title", description="Optional description")
Returns dashboard_id — save it for chart creation and assembly.
create_chart)Create visualization charts referencing the dataset.
create_chart(
chart_type="bar", # bar, line, pie, table, big_number, scatter
title="Chart Title",
dataset_id="<from step 2>",
dashboard_id="<from step 4>",
metrics="revenue,COUNT(order_id)",
x_axis="date_column",
dimensions="category"
)

After assembling the dashboard, finish the run and return the created IDs.
bi-validation is a validator skill invoked automatically by
ValidationHook.on_end; do not call load_skill("bi-validation") or try to
run validator checks manually.
Publish is complete when the creation calls succeed and the dashboard / chart /
dataset identifiers are known. The framework validates reachability and wiring
after the agent run ends. Return the dashboard_id,
dataset_id, and chart_ids. Treat follow-up layout or chart rewiring as a
separate update request.
| Action | Tool | Notes |
|---|---|---|
| List dashboards | list_dashboards(search="keyword") | Filter by keyword |
| Get dashboard details | get_dashboard(dashboard_id="...") | Full info including charts |
| List charts in dashboard | list_charts(dashboard_id="...") | All charts with config |
| Get chart details | get_chart(chart_id="...") | Full chart definition and query details |
| Get chart data | get_chart_data(chart_id="...", limit=10) | Query result rows for numeric validation |
| List datasets | list_datasets() | All registered datasets |
| List BI databases | list_bi_databases() | Database connections in Superset |
